THE CUSTOMER’S OBLIGATIONS. The Customer agrees that it will:- 8.1 pay the Supplier all amounts due under this On-Site Warranty Agreement at the due times, which will be stated on the invoices issued pursuant to clause 3. 8.2 ensure that the Equipment is not: 8.2.1 moved at any time from the address at which it was originally installed, 8.2.2 altered, adjusted or interfered with in any way except by the Supplier's servants or agents. Alterations include the reprogramming of the Equipment to change network providers for the purpose of least cost routing; 8.3 provide the Supplier with full access to the Equipment during the hours of the agreed service level to enable On-Site Warranty Services to the Equipment to be carried out; 8.4 pay the Supplier's charges for reprogramming the Equipment required as a result of an error by any person other than the Supplier's servants or agents; 8.5 not alter or extend the Equipment without prior notification to the Supplier (an additional charge may, at the Supplier's sole discretion be made for the repair/replacement of altered Equipment); 8.6 provide the Supplier with details of the installer of the Equipment, a copy of its Pre- Connection Inspection Certificate and access to all relevant site records; 8.7 reasonably request works under this contract and agrees where applicable that any usage in excess of Fair Usage, could, at the Suppliers discretion, incur an additional charge pursuant to clause 9.3.
